I had to do some modifications to the front coilovers to adjust the camber enough so the wheels wont touch the coilover
The car is as low as i want, and pretty much ready for an alignment
I booked a time for the allignment, and with my luck, the exhaust is to low for the machine to connect left/right side. So no allignment for me :/

As every other S13, the inner door handles were starting to crack, so i had to do some plastic"welding". Bought a cheap welding gun in the ebay. and it worked perfect. Hopefuly the door handle wont crack now
